Understanding the Nishi-Shinjuku location context
Location in Tokyo is not just about the neighborhood, but about the specific side of the district. Nishi-Shinjuku is the skyscraper district, characterized by wide roads and corporate headquarters. While this means the hotel is away from the noise of the Kabukicho area, it also means that walking distances can be longer than they appear on a map. International travelers should verify their primary destinations and check the local transport links to avoid unexpected commute times.
The practical benefit of this location is the sense of space and the availability of professional services. However, those who want to be steps away from the smallest bars in the world or the busiest shopping alleys may find the walk from Nishi-Shinjuku to the East side of the station a bit taxing. It is worth confirming the hotel's transportation options or shuttle availability to bridge this gap during peak travel hours.
Room expectations and avoiding booking mistakes
One of the most common points of friction for travelers booking in Tokyo is the discrepancy between room photos and actual square footage. At Hyatt Regency Tokyo, room categories vary significantly. While some rooms are standard, others include separate living rooms which are essential for those traveling with more luggage or requiring a workspace. Travelers should carefully check the room category name before finalizing the payment to ensure they are not booking a room that feels too restrictive for their needs.
Bed configurations are another area where errors often occur. In Japan, a "Twin" room consists of two separate beds, while a "Double" or "King" is a single large bed. For couples or small families, booking the wrong bed setup can lead to uncomfortable stays. It is also worth noting that specific features like blackout curtains are available in a selection of rooms, which is a critical detail for those dealing with heavy jet lag from long-haul flights.
Additionally, travelers should verify which rooms include the executive lounge access. The lounge provides a more cozy and furnished environment for relaxation, which can be a significant value-add for those who prefer to avoid crowded public lobbies or cafes during their stay.
Practical amenities to verify for a city stay
The utility of the on-site facilities often determines the ease of a short-term stay. The presence of a convenience store within the hotel is a practical advantage, allowing guests to pick up travel essentials without needing to navigate the city streets late at night. For those maintaining a routine, the fitness center and spa/salon services provide a way to manage the physical toll of city walking and jet lag.
Internet access is complimentary, but for business travelers, the stability and speed of the connection should be confirmed based on the current room category. Similarly, while the hotel provides laundry and dry cleaning services, travelers should check the turnaround time and costs if they are staying for more than a few days. These operational details are often what separate a seamless stay from one filled with minor inconveniences.
